At its core, the request for a net worth statement through interrogatories is a formal demand for a snapshot of financial reality. Unlike casual inquiries or vague requests, interrogatories are written questions submitted by one party to another, requiring sworn answers under the penalties of perjury. When specifically targeted at net worth, the questions become highly specific, seeking a valuation of assets versus liabilities at a particular moment in time. In Missouri, the rules governing civil procedure, particularly Rule 570.010 regarding interrogatories, allow for this targeted financial scrutiny to ensure a level playing field. The primary goal is to prevent the dissipation of assets or the creation of fraudulent liabilities in anticipation of a judgment. Whether the case involves a contentious divorce seeking equitable distribution, a breach of contract dispute where solvency is at issue, or a personal injury claim where the defendant's insurance limits are in question, knowing the true financial picture of the opposing party is invaluable. This transparency is the bedrock of fairness in the judicial system, ensuring that a party cannot hide behind a veil of insolvency or misrepresent their financial capacity to settle or fulfill a court order.
